rugby b division finals today. i think there were at least 800 rafflesians around, possibly even more than 1000.
during the match we basically lived and died, cheered and cried with the rugby team.
unfortunately it didn't quite happen for us.
it ended acs(i) 15 ri 11.
and we conceded the winning try in the last 10 minutes. painful to take really.
at the end of the match it was quite emotional for a while when the school crowded around the rugby boys and cheered them on. some of the rugby boys were crying, and the school was crying with them, and i shed a few tears myself.
why? well it's been 17 years since we last won, that's one. we were 10 minutes away from doing it again.
the rugby boys played their hearts out. i don't think we could have asked for any more from them.
it's just sad that there could only be one winner.
but we have nothing to regret, nothing to be ashamed of. and i guess today marked the rebirth (somewhat) of the spirit which we have seemed to lack in recent years.
rugby is probably the biggest sport in ri. i think sending 16 classes down for the final made that quite clear. and the additional people who came down numbered in the hundreds.
so maybe that's what gets us going. support for something which has been starved of glory for so long.
but although they didn't have any trophy to show for it, they did the school proud today. they earned the respect of the supporters.
good job to all you ruggers.
